Designing plant ecosystems
This talk will delve into the topic of plant polycultures and guilds. We can design plant communities to support the ecosystem of the whole design by meeting the needs of the plants. We can add in fertility plants and living mulches in the form of ground cover plants.
I will start by defining a polyculture and a guild. I will talk about the different roles plants can play in an ecosystem and how we can use those properties to design a thriving community of plants regardless of whether the purpose of the planting is to be edible, medicinal or solely ornamental
